Fearghus writes:

>>>>1.	While the rules do state that UHMW is legal on wood shafted arrows,
I have not tried this, but will. I may change the wording on this to state
that UHMW is only legal on fiberglass.<<<<

I'm assuming that this is because of potential problems with securing the
wood shaft in the head? I suspect that it's possible to securely fit them
in, either by drilling the holes slightly undersize or inserting the shaft
after taping. With the requirement that the heads be taped on, they should
work as well or better then standard Markland-style heads do. I don't see a
reason to ban the combination unless there's a problem that I've
not heard of...
